Output 7f6bb8b2b4b03b60943aea2351cfb21d6bd52a154c1c03e94511c42ea62d2f54:1

value
2001467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b997ad12f37826b87b2fc3af29d5577669837fe2 OP_EQUAL
address
3JcLdfqr19bfaUeP5y6UQHCct29VeSDGqD
transaction
7f6bb8b2b4b03b60943aea2351cfb21d6bd52a154c1c03e94511c42ea62d2f54
confirmations
361889
spent
true